snow like wild water

Heavy wind comes up. It churns up the snow and chases it over the slopes. The sun is swallowed up by the snow whirl. The harsh gusts blow the hard snow crystals into my face. It gets cold and I no longer feel my feet. But I want to reach the edge of the mountain. I cross the glacier and come to the refuge. It is nearly completely covered by snow. Only a tiny part of the gable protrudes. Over the hut roof I do the last steps to the edge of the mountain. Fascinating are the structures and formations of wind-swept snow. It rushes over the rocks and snowcraters like wild mountain water. But it gets very cold and uncomfortable. It is not so easy to take a picture. I am worried that the hard snow crystals are scratching the photolins. Highest time to reverse.

Dachstein, Upper Austria.
